Seaview - The Bay Course

About
The Bay Course is one of two 18-hole courses that the Seaview offers. Designed by famed golf course designer, Donald Ross, it was the first course of the resort and it is also the more famous of the two. Over the years, they made renovations but it was eventually restored to Ross' original links design.
The greens are small and undulating and the Atlantic winds definitely play a huge role in the game. The 2nd hole is the signature hole with a yardage of 432 and a par of 4 that can where the ocean serves as a hazard. Seaview's Bay Course also hosts the ShopRite LPGA Classic.
